Gravity, lithograph, hand-coloured, 1952. "Here is another star dodecahedron, bordered by twelve flat five-pointed stars. On each of these platforms lives a tailless monster with a long neck and four legs. Its torso is trapped under a five-sided pyramid with walls, each with an opening, through which the animal protrudes its head and legs. But the pointed end of a platform on which one animal lives is also the wall of the dungeon of one of its fellow sufferers. All these triangular ends therefore have the double function of a floor as a wall." ~ M.C. Escher, Grafiek en Tekeningen. Printed in color on poster paper. Paper size : 55 x 65 cm. Tower of Babel, woodcut, 1928. "It was assumed that the different races also emerged during the confusion of tongues; hence some construction workers are white, others black. The work has come to a standstill because they no longer understand each other. Since the quintessence of the drama takes place at the top of the tower under construction, it was shown, as if in a bird's eye view, from above. This resulted in the need for a strong perspective shift downwards." ~ M.C. Escher, Grafiek en Tekeningen. Printed in black and white on 170 gram paper. Paper size : 55 x 65 cm. Encounter, lithograph, 1944. "From the gray edges of a back wall, a complicated pattern of white and black human figures develops. Since people who want to live need at least a floor to walk on, one was designed for them, with a circular hole in it, so that, as much of the back wall as possible, remains visible. As a result, they are also forced to walk in a circle and meet each other in the foreground: a white optimist and a black pessimist, who shake hands." ~ M.C. Escher, Grafiek en Tekeningen.
